Purpose Investments, an asset management firm that sits in Toronto, and is independent of $23bn AUM, has submitted paperwork with Canadian securities regulators to establish the Purpose Ripple ETF. This exchange-traded fund has the objective of giving investors direct investment in XRP because it is affiliated with Ripple Labs.
The strategy of Purpose Ripple ETF is to invest the majority of the assets in the long-term in XRP. Instead, it seeks to provide investors with a way to make a profit in the long term without owning the XRP token.
Som Seif, the founder and CEO of Purpose Investments stated on the increase of institutional interest in XRP: “With continued adoption and the desire for regulated exposure to XRP, it appears an ETF can provide a familiar product structure for investors.”
Vlad Tasevski, Chief Innovation Officer of Purpose Investments, commented and said that this marks another step forward for the group in its endeavor to be the go-to and most relied-on partner when it comes to investing in crypto and digital assets, by making them accessible while helping investors to fully comprehend and invest in them effectively.
Expanding Digital Asset Offerings
Moreover, Purpose Investments has launched two other products in the past, this is the spot Bitcoin and Ether ETFs which highlights the firm’s ambitions of offering exposure to revolutionary digital assets and blockchain technologies through regulated investment products. The proposed XRP ETF is in tune with this strategy since it seeks to link traditional finance to decentralized finance.
The filing was made when there was an upsurge in the applications of cryptocurrency exchange-traded funds. Most notably, NYSE Arca proposed to change the investment in Grayscale’s XRP Trust into the spot bitcoin ETF with Coinbase Custody as a custodian and BNY Mellon Asset Servicing as a transfer agent.
